Transaction 306e76368341e9574f7429f205c0832536ecbf3aa904c9f3a044d613de0959af

1 Input
2 Outputs
  • 306e76368341e9574f7429f205c0832536ecbf3aa904c9f3a044d613de0959af:0
  • value  113856
    address  32MLrXJb1exyDc1EeSiZw3Af88tqRmh7Fj
  • 306e76368341e9574f7429f205c0832536ecbf3aa904c9f3a044d613de0959af:1
  • value  15293013
    address  3ADKuRrXaopsdQkPTLS3nSuiZHfDgeSimQ